
Get unified visibility into your email authentication posture and reach full DMARC enforcement with deeper reporting, record analysis, and SPF audits free for every Cloudflare customer.
Amidst increasing cyber threats and regulatory pressures, robust email security and authentication are critical for enterprises to maintain trust and protect against phishing and spoofing attacks. Cloudflare's expansion into DMARC management aligns with its broader strategy of securing internet infrastructure services.
This offering simplifies complex DMARC implementation and enforcement, making advanced email authentication more accessible to a wider range of organizations. It enhances the overall security posture against prevalent email-based cyberattacks, reducing financial and reputational risks for businesses.
Organizations, especially Cloudflare customers, now have a more integrated and potentially free tool for managing their email authentication, shifting DMARC from a specialized IT task to a more accessible security feature. This can lead to broader adoption of DMARC enforcement among Cloudflare's user base.

Increased adoption of DMARC enforcement across Cloudflare's customer base will improve email security for many organizations.
A more secure email ecosystem could lead to fewer successful phishing and business email compromise (BEC) attacks, reducing financial losses and data breaches.
As email authentication becomes standard, advanced attackers may pivot to other ingress vectors, driving further innovation in endpoint and identity security.
